KUSA-TV (Denver, CO)

KUSA, also known as channel 9, is a TV station located in Denver, Colorado, and is affiliated with NBC. The station is owned by Tegna Inc., which also owns KTVD, a MyNetworkTV affiliate on channel 20. Both KUSA and KTVD have their studios situated on East Speer Boulevard in the Speer neighborhood of Denver. KUSA's transmitter is positioned on Lookout Mountain, close to Golden. Additionally, the station has a secondary studio and a news bureau located on Riverside Avenue in Fort Collins.

    GREELEY, Colo. — High school students from Greeley West put their horticultural skills to work to beautify the downtown 8th Street Plaza through a community collaboration project with the city. The students, part of Greeley West High School's horticulture and landscape design classes, planted approximately 800 plants Thursday as the final phase of an eight-month beautification project coordinated with the Greeley Public Works Department.

    ASPEN, Colo. — The Winter X Games returns to Aspen in 2026 for their 25th year, organizers announced Monday. The event is scheduled for Jan. 23–25, 2026, and will once again be hosted at Buttermilk Mountain, where the games have been held annually since 2002. The milestone event comes just days before the start of the2026 Winter Olympics in Italy, adding excitement as top athletes prepare to compete on the world stage.

    DENVER — Police activity shut down Regional Transportation District service at Union Station on Tuesday afternoon, causing significant disruptions for afternoon commuters as multiple rail lines were suspended. RTD announced the closure of Union Station due to a police investigation after a suspicious package was left unattended on a train platform. RTD said shuttle buses are replacing the A, B, G, and N lines for at least part of their routes.
